I have done it & the header that goes with that varable intake is alot of the problem.If you run a euro 3.5 header it would probley fit in correctly but may affect some of your hp's,with the intake.as far as the hook ups & wiring.The harness is fits but does require some mods to deal with the diagnosis connector.It of corse will require not only the 3.6 dme but also the intake control module assy.With lighten flywheel,chip upgrade,ram air,monsterflow air filter,dyno showed 287 at rear wheels.My car only weights 2732 lbs too.

I personally haven't done it , but I seem to recall that it's not that hard. Most of the wiring matches up, you will need the correct DME- it bolts right up and plugs in, exhast will need to be matched or better yet opened up, e34 headers are different as well. As far as fitment- it's an S38 block. That's all I know.
